Up in ND, they're concentrated in the beans and sugar beats. I'm seeing more in the beets right now, but some in the beans and alfalfa as well. Come the first frost, they'll move into sunflowers, corn and more of the alfalfa. Come opener of rifle season when everyone stirs them up, they'll stay in the unharvested corn and sunflowers to never be heard of again.....
